Therapy can be helpful for a wide variety of psychological health conditions. In this post, we’ll check out 10 different conditions that people may have and how treatment can assist.
Depression is a common mental health condition that affects millions of people worldwide. Therapy can assist by supplying a safe space to discuss your feelings and feelings. A therapist can help you determine negative idea patterns and habits and deal with you to develop coping techniques and favorable practices.
Stress and anxiety is another common mental health condition that can be disabling. Treatment can assist by teaching you relaxation methods, such as deep breathing and mindfulness, and working with you to develop coping techniques to manage anxiety triggers.
PTSD, or post-traumatic stress disorder, is a mental health condition that can establish after experiencing or seeing a terrible event. Treatment can help by supplying a safe space to process the trauma and establish coping methods to handle the signs of PTSD.
OCD, or obsessive-compulsive condition, is a mental health condition identified by compulsive behaviors and intrusive thoughts. Treatment can assist by teaching you how to identify and manage these ideas and behaviors, along with establish coping techniques to handle the signs of OCD. Betterhelp Email Therapy Plan Cost
Bipolar disorder
Bipolar affective disorder is a psychological health condition defined by extreme mood swings, ranging from depressive episodes to manic episodes. Treatment can help by offering assistance and assistance in handling these state of mind swings, establishing coping methods, and improving communication skills.
Eating disorders
Eating disorders, such as anorexia and bulimia, are psychological health conditions that can have severe physical repercussions. Treatment can help by resolving the underlying emotional and mental problems that contribute to the eating disorder, as well as establishing methods to manage the physical signs.
Substance abuse
Substance abuse can be a difficult practice to break, but therapy can be an effective tool in handling dependency. Treatment can assist by addressing the underlying psychological and emotional problems that contribute to substance abuse, in addition to developing strategies to manage yearnings and sets off.
Relationship issues
Relationship concerns, such as interaction issues and conflict, can have a considerable influence on mental health. Treatment can assist by providing a safe area to go over these concerns and develop methods to enhance interaction and deal with dispute.
Grief and loss can be a challenging experience to navigate, but therapy can assist by providing support and assistance through the grieving procedure. A therapist can assist you recognize and handle the emotions related to grief and loss, along with develop coping strategies to progress.
Stress management
Tension is a typical experience for lots of people, but it can have unfavorable effect on mental health. Treatment can assist by teaching relaxation techniques and establishing coping techniques to manage tension, along with determining and dealing with the underlying psychological and emotional problems that add to tension.
In conclusion, treatment can be an efficient tool in managing a wide variety of mental health conditions, from depression and anxiety to drug abuse and relationship concerns. If you are struggling with your mental health, consider seeking the assistance and assistance of a certified therapist.
Seeing a therapist can have many advantages for an individual’s psychological health and wellbeing. Here are some of the benefits of seeing a therapist from a psychological point of view:
Increased self-awareness
Among the main benefits of seeing a therapist is increased self-awareness. A therapist can help you determine patterns in your feelings, ideas, and habits, along with the underlying beliefs and values that drive them. By ending up being more familiar with these patterns, you can gain a deeper understanding of yourself and your inspirations, which can lead to individual development and advancement.
Improved emotional regulation
Psychological policy is the capability to handle and manage one’s emotions in an adaptive and healthy method. Seeing a therapist can assist individuals discover and practice emotional policy methods, such as deep breathing and mindfulness, that can be handy in handling hard feelings and reducing tension.
Much better social relationships
Social relationships are a crucial element of mental health and health and wellbeing. Seeing a therapist can assist people enhance their communication abilities, assertiveness, and empathy, which can result in much healthier and more fulfilling relationships with others.
Increased problem-solving skills
Treatment can also assist people develop problem-solving abilities. By working with a therapist, people can find out to method issues in a more systematic and effective way, determine possible services, and make decisions that are lined up with their goals and worths.
Enhanced self-confidence
Self-confidence refers to a person’s sense of self-respect and value. Seeing a therapist can assist individuals identify and challenge negative self-talk and beliefs that can contribute to low self-confidence. Through treatment, people can learn to establish a more realistic and favorable self-image, which can cause increased self-confidence and self-respect.
Enhanced coping skills
Coping abilities are techniques and methods that people utilize to handle tension and difficulty. Seeing a therapist can help individuals establish and practice coping skills that are tailored to their specific requirements and preferences. Coping skills can include mindfulness, relaxation methods, analytical, and social support, among others.
Minimized signs of mental illness
Therapy can also work in minimizing symptoms of mental illness, such as anxiety, stress and anxiety, and trauma (PTSD). Therapists use evidence-based treatments, such as c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), dialectical behavior therapy (DBT), and eye movement des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R), to assist people manage symptoms and improve their overall quality of life.
